Commit graph

4227 commits

Author SHA1 Message Date
Michael Kirk 05b200c607 "Bump build to 2.27.0.5." 2018-06-25 18:20:00 -06:00
Michael Kirk 4576747bb7 sync translations 2018-06-25 18:19:27 -06:00
Michael Kirk 38ee3653f7 synchronize access to CaptureController state
// FREEBIE
2018-06-25 17:43:54 -06:00
Michael Kirk af603e53c7 remove more unused state from PCC 2018-06-25 15:44:57 -06:00
Michael Kirk 61156656aa Only PCC needs to know about the local RTCTrack 2018-06-25 15:21:27 -06:00
Michael Kirk afa385feae adapt to capturer abstraction 2018-06-25 15:03:25 -06:00
Michael Kirk 0cd1cb80cc Compiling, but video sending not working. 2018-06-25 15:03:25 -06:00
Michael Kirk 064035f3f4 WIP M67 - plumb through AVCaptureSession
TODO:

-[x] plumb through AVCaptureSession
-[] get AVCaptureSession from PeerConnectionClient
-[] RTCDataChannel not unwrapped
-[] no member avFoundationSource
-[] no member "back camera"
2018-06-25 15:03:25 -06:00
Michael Kirk 825e3f4ac0 "Bump build to 2.27.0.4." 2018-06-22 15:04:52 -06:00
Michael Kirk 0419f52262 sync translations
// FREEBIE
2018-06-22 15:04:36 -06:00
Michael Kirk 9d56f100ab Don't show unread badge/bold for search message
// FREEBIE
2018-06-22 14:38:53 -06:00
Michael Kirk 489bbe2fcc FIX: mute icon corrupted in homeview
Don't clobber icon font

// FREEBIE
2018-06-22 14:03:16 -06:00
Michael Kirk 9b43e32332 FIX: input toolbar not immediately visible when search was active
// FREEBIE
2018-06-22 13:49:36 -06:00
Michael Kirk 9f06163b76 Fix contacts reminder view
We had a guard that prevented 'called at least once' from ever getting set when contacts access was disabled.

// FREEBIE
2018-06-22 13:49:05 -06:00
Michael Kirk 66ebb7b787 Simplify show/hide with stack view
// FREEBIE
2018-06-22 13:49:05 -06:00
Michael Kirk 1528f6f705 Fix archive/outage banner.
// FREEBIE
2018-06-22 13:49:05 -06:00
Michael Kirk 676f8fc030 "Bump build to 2.27.0.3." 2018-06-21 18:06:15 -06:00
Michael Kirk def7e84155 Sync translations
// FREEBIE
2018-06-21 17:56:48 -06:00
Matthew Chen 2ecbf1bb65 Fix 'contact cell vs. message details layout' issue. 2018-06-21 17:16:50 -06:00
Matthew Chen 1a57fe631c Fix 'contact cell vs. message details layout' issue. 2018-06-21 17:16:50 -06:00
Matthew Chen 27af2fc328 Improve app settings buttons. 2018-06-21 17:29:00 -04:00
Matthew Chen 525fc547b9 Apply copy change. 2018-06-21 17:28:13 -04:00
Matthew Chen a7a9eb2a73 "Bump build to 2.27.0.2." 2018-06-21 17:23:50 -04:00
Michael Kirk cc1bde34cd Inform iPad users upon registration
// FREEBIE
2018-06-21 15:02:37 -06:00
Matthew Chen f516f30c26 Auto-dismiss search keyboard; "cancel search" button. 2018-06-21 16:12:28 -04:00
Michael Kirk 6933e28e47 update comment 2018-06-21 11:25:00 -06:00
riyapenn-signal 3952954b02 Update Localizable.strings for minor copy change to Registration view
Changed "Activate This Device" to "Register" to be at parity with Signal Android
Changed one comment from "deactivated" to "unregistered"
2018-06-21 11:22:30 -06:00
Matthew Chen 4bd3f8cbf6 "Bump build to 2.27.0.1." 2018-06-20 18:10:25 -04:00
Matthew Chen 63b6276c25 Clear LRUCache in background. 2018-06-20 17:55:15 -04:00
Matthew Chen 87ea1dcae1 Clean up ahead of PR. 2018-06-20 17:55:15 -04:00
Matthew Chen 08ca4fdb50 Lazy-load contact avatar data and images. Use NSCache for avatar images. 2018-06-20 17:55:14 -04:00
Matthew Chen af977ca409 Don't cache CNContact. 2018-06-20 17:55:14 -04:00
Matthew Chen 41a2ea03b0 Don't cache CNContact. 2018-06-20 17:55:14 -04:00
Matthew Chen d3d9d2e64c Don't cache CNContact. 2018-06-20 17:55:14 -04:00
Matthew Chen 83f11ad79b Don't cache CNContact. 2018-06-20 17:55:14 -04:00
Matthew Chen 12295bd8c5 Don't cache CNContact. 2018-06-20 17:55:14 -04:00
Matthew Chen 1eb02bfd92 Outage detection. 2018-06-20 17:50:50 -04:00
Matthew Chen ae50dbe198 Outage detection. 2018-06-20 17:50:50 -04:00
Matthew Chen 793a868e6f Outage detection. 2018-06-20 17:50:50 -04:00
Matthew Chen c96e2bb8b4 Outage detection. 2018-06-20 17:50:50 -04:00
Matthew Chen 1607aa7f57 Image content types. 2018-06-20 17:13:31 -04:00
Matthew Chen 4ac8100973 Respond to CR. 2018-06-20 15:15:33 -04:00
Matthew Chen 010c10cb0c Show re-registration in app settings. 2018-06-20 14:54:16 -04:00
Matthew Chen bc6a4ea8d8 Add re-registration UI. 2018-06-20 14:54:16 -04:00
Matthew Chen 6331fbb22a Show de-registration nag view. 2018-06-20 14:54:16 -04:00
Matthew Chen b0646e8bff Track and persist 'is de-registered' state. 2018-06-20 14:54:16 -04:00
Matthew Chen 0b64ecf675 Respond to CR. 2018-06-20 14:46:24 -04:00
Matthew Chen 6ca3688cd4 "Bump build to 2.27.0.0." 2018-06-19 12:58:05 -04:00
Matthew Chen 32336e38e1 Merge tag '2.26.0.26' 2018-06-15 11:47:23 -04:00
Matthew Chen 9b948141d0 "Bump build to 2.26.0.26." 2018-06-15 11:41:46 -04:00